A process of producing shaped bodies for gasification of solid fuels under a pressure between 5 and 150 bars by a treatment with gasifying agents which contain oxygen, water vapor and/or carbon dioxide, wherein the fuel is formed into a fixed bed, which slowly moves downwardly, the gasifying agents are introduced into the fixed bed from below, and the incombustible mineral constituents of the fuel are withdrawn under the fixed bed as solid ash or liquid slag, said shaped bodies are formed from a fuel mixture containing fine-grained caking coal which softens in a certain temperature range, characterized in that at least two kinds of fine-grained caking coal are used for said mixture, said kinds of caking coal have different softening temperature ranges, the content of each kind in the mixture being at least 25% by weight. |
